When a person sins then he dies spiritually:

"What fruit had ye then in those things whereof ye are now ashamed? for the end of those things is death...For the wages of sin is death; but the gift of God is eternal life through Jesus Christ our Lord"
(Ro.6:21,23).​

Since a person dies spiritually when he sins that means he must be alive spiritually before he sins. And in the preceding chapter Paul makes it plain that "all men" die spiritually when they sin:

"Wherefore, as by one man sin entered into the world, and death by sin; and so death passed upon all men, for that all have sinned"
(Ro.5:12).​

Since "all men" die spiritually as a result of their own sin then that means "all men" are alive spiritually before they sin. That can only mean that all men emerge from the womb spiritually alive.
